Bockman Campground — State Forest State Park
About
State Park
This campground is located one mile north of the North Michigan Reservoir within view of the Medicine Bow mountain range. It hosts 52 sites. There are 13 pull-through sites and one group area with six sites.
Features: The Bockman horse corral is located near the pull-through sites. Campground accommodations include vault toilet facilities and water spigots.

Directions
From I-70 to the Empire exit, Highway 40, over Berthoud Pass through Winter Park and Granby. 2 miles west of Granby take Highway 125 45 miles to the east side of Rand. Take County Road 27 14 miles to Highway 14, go right to the park 3 miles. From Fort Collins: Take 287 to Highway 14 along the Poudre River 75 miles. When you hit the summit of Cameron Pass you are in the State Forest State Park. The Moose Visitor Center is 8 miles west of the summit.
